About ATHDX

American Century Heritage Fund R6 Class is a mutual fund designed to pursue long-term capital growth by primarily investing in stocks of medium-sized companies that the adviser identifies as having strong growth potential. Classified in the mid-cap growth category, it focuses on U.S. firms with higher price-to-book ratios and forecasted growth values, typically maintaining a portfolio concentrated in medium-cap stocks while including some large-cap, small-cap, and micro-cap holdings. The fund adopts an opportunistic growth strategy, emphasizing sectors such as information technology, industrials, health care, and consumer discretionary, with a portfolio turnover rate around 51 percent. Its asset allocation is predominantly domestic stocks, comprising over 97 percent of the portfolio, supplemented by minor non-U.S. stock exposure. Available exclusively to group employer-sponsored retirement plans, this R6 share class features a competitive gross expense ratio and no sales loads or 12b-1 fees. Managed by American Century Investments, the fund benchmarks against the Russell Midcap Growth Index, targeting investors seeking exposure to dynamic mid-cap growth opportunities within their retirement portfolios.
